Mubarak, Maliki review preparations for two conferences on Iraq
Egypt's President Hosni Mubarak yesterday had important talks with Iraq's Prime Minister Nouri al-Maliki on the latest developments in Iraq, Egypt's efforts for maintaining stability and unity of the Iraqi people, and preparations for the two conference on Iraq which will be held in Sharm el-Sheikh early next month.

Al Azhar Sheikh urges boycott of the press insulting the prophet
Grand Sheikh of al-Azhar Mohamed Sayed Tantawi, ascertained that any abuse against the holy prophet and his companions in some papers and magazines is a kind of ugliness, adding that he who promotes them is a blasphemous void of all virtues.

Regional cooperation to curb children's labor
National Council for Childhood and Motherhood (NCCM) together with the Regional Program to Curb Children's Labor discussed best ways to cooperate to address worst forms of children's labor.
